The word Aws is an abbreviation of the word (Ohio Kazimas), which means Japanese, good morning
The basic principle in choosing this word is that the training was previously starting in the morning, so when entering the exercise, the player said to the coach, Ohio Kazimas, then shortened to Aws (the first letter of Ohio and the last letter of Kazimas) and the word became linked to the exercise even if it started at another time.
It is used to exchange greeting and respect between coaches and players in general as follows:
When you meet or see the coach, we salute him with the word Aws and greet him.
And when a player meets with another player, some of them live with the word Os.
When entering or leaving the training hall (dogo).
When you ask you to greet you, that is, when performing the salutation at the beginning and last of the lesson, and in the matches.
Or as permission, as inquiries, or as an apology from the coach or another player.
Or express the understanding means when the trainer explains one of the points or the movement of what the word Os is used in the sense that I understood.
Or a match for approval, I mean, for example, the trainer asks you, have you exercised at home, and you say to him Osi, I mean, yes, you have exercised.
